Transportation of gases in tracheophytes
Whether the transportation of the gases within tracheophytes are made through the vascular tissues?
Expert
Carbon dioxide and oxygen are generally not transported through the xylem or phloem. These gases arrive at the cells and move out the plant by the process of diffusion through the intercellular spaces or between the neighboring cells.
